步骤如下 1.假设我需要把user.csv保存为utf8编码格式 如果你使用libreoffice打开该文件时会提示选择字符编码类型,可以看到utf8直接乱码,所以我们就找一个不乱码的字符编码进去就可以了 2.然后直接复制里面的内容到另一个新建的文本中,选择另存为csv文件 确认保存 选择保存的文件编码为utf8 3.现在我们打开另存为的...
window新建的txt、wps默认是ANSI编码格式 比如csv文件,修改编码格式为UTF-8: 第一步:选中已经转换好的csv文件,并右击鼠标,选择【打开方式】-【记事本】 第二步:点击【文件】-【另存为】 第三步:编码选择UTF-8后,点击【保存】 这样修改之后的csv文件的编码就是UTF-8了。
如何利用python批量将csv文件编码格式改为utf8呢? 可以使用os库以及chardet库中的方法,进行遍历循环文件名称,然后修改编码格式 from os import listdir from chardet import detect fns = (fn for fn in listdir() if fn.endswith('.csv')) for fn in fns: with open(fn, 'rb+') as fp: content = fp...
步骤一:读取UTF-8格式的CSV文件 首先,我们需要使用Python的csv模块来读取UTF-8格式的CSV文件。我们可以使用以下代码来读取CSV文件并将其内容存储在一个列表中: importcsv data=[]withopen('input_file.csv','r',encoding='utf-8')asfile:csv_reader=csv.reader(file)forrowincsv_reader:data.append(row) 1....